The province’s Special Investigations Unit is invoking its mandate following a police-involved shooting in Mississauga early Thursday.
Investigators are on scene near Creditview Rd. and Britannia Rd. W. where early reports indicate a teenager was shot around 2 a.m.
More information is being released later today, said SIU spokesperson Jason Gennaro.
Northbound Creditview at Britannia is closed as of 6:15 a.m.
Avoid the area.
UPDATE: The plaza at Creditview and Britannia will be closed for several hours for the investigation, Gennaro said at 8:25 a.m., and all businesses are affected.
